You are right when you say this will take time to sort out. We can’t undo the mess in a day. The anxiety and racing thoughts can be terrible and difficult. I just reminded myself that my loved ones wanted me to be with them and well. That gambling or suicide wasn’t an answer. And as I was reminded by the good people here all I needed to focus on was the next task, or the next right choice. One step at a time can be the beginning of an amazing journey. Deep breathing, meditation if possible, practicing self care, all these things can help with the anxiety. The bills can feel overwhelming. Focus on paying for the necessities. Roof over head, food on the table, petrol in the car for work. And of course quality time with your son can help ease the ill feelings. I’m sure he’s thrilled to kick around a ball or watch his favourite show with you. Take care and keep us posted.
